Window Solutions: Enhancing Your Home’s Aesthetics and Efficiency

Windows are typically considered the eyes of a home, supplying natural light, fresh air, and a welcoming view of the outdoors. However, they are not merely structural elements; they are important to a structure’s façade, energy effectiveness, and security. 1.2. Energy-efficient Windows

Created with advanced glazing strategies and insulation, energy-efficient windows reduce energy loss and assistance maintain stable indoor temperatures. They generally have a low-E (low emissivity) finishing that reflects infrared light while permitting noticeable light to enter.

1.3. Specialized Windows

These consist of custom-shaped windows like pentagonal, circle-top, or seasonal windows. Specialized windows are frequently utilized to include special architectural flair or to fit unconventional areas.

1.4. Smart Windows

Smart windows use technology to manage the quantity of light and heat that goes through. These windows can automatically tint in reaction to sunshine or be from another location controlled by means of clever home systems.

2. Benefits of Upgrading Your Windows

Upgrading windows can yield numerous benefits, including however not limited to:

  • Energy Efficiency: Improved insulation can result in lower energy bills and boosted convenience inside your home.
  • Aesthetic Appeal: Modern windows can considerably boost the appearance of a home, boosting its curb appeal.
  • Increased Property Value: High-quality window solutions can make homes more attractive to prospective buyers.
  • Boosted Security: Many modern windows come with robust locking mechanisms and shatter-resistant glass.
  • Noise Reduction: Quality windows can lessen external sound pollution, creating a more serene living environment.

4. FAQs about Window Solutions

What is the life-span of modern windows?

A lot of modern windows can last between 15 to 30 years, depending upon the materials utilized and environmental conditions.

How can I inform if my windows need replacement?

Signs may include drafts, condensation in between the panes, or noticeable fading of interior furnishings due to UV exposure.

Are energy-efficient windows really worth the financial investment?

Yes; while they may have a greater in advance cost, the long-lasting savings on energy bills and improved comfort often validate the investment.

What are the best window styles for energy efficiency?

Double or triple-glazed windows with low-E coatings are considered among the best options for energy efficiency.

Can windows be fixed instead of changed?

In many cases, repair work can be made, such as changing weather condition stripping or re-sealing. However, if windows are substantially old or damaged, replacement may be the much better option.
